Risk Factors for Water Heater Leaks in Hillside
- Hard Water Mineral Buildup: The Chicago area, including Hillside, has notoriously hard water with high concentrations of calcium and magnesium. These minerals accumulate inside water heater tanks over time, forming sediment that reduces efficiency, increases pressure inside the tank, and accelerates corrosion of the tank's interior walls. Higher pressure and corrosion together create conditions where small leaks are more likely to develop into catastrophic failures.
- Age of Residential Stock: Many Hillside homes are 50+ years old, and their original water heaters—or replacements installed years ago—may be nearing or past their typical 10–15 year lifespan. Older tanks are more prone to rust, corrosion, and structural failure. Even if a water heater was replaced in the 1990s or early 2000s, it is now at high risk of failure due to age alone.
- Inadequate Maintenance and Flushing: Sediment buildup is slowed by regular flushing and anode-rod replacement, but many homeowners are unaware of these maintenance needs. Without annual or biennial flushing, sediment accumulates rapidly in hard-water regions like Hillside, accelerating tank degradation and increasing the likelihood of leaks.
- Pressure and Temperature Relief Valve Failures: Sediment buildup and corrosion can also affect the temperature and pressure relief (TPR) valve, which is designed to release excess pressure or heat from the tank. A faulty TPR valve can fail to release pressure, causing stress on the tank, or it can weep continuously if corroded, wasting water and signaling imminent tank failure.
- Improper Installation or Incompatible Systems: Water heaters installed without proper support, incorrect venting, or in damp basements are more vulnerable to external corrosion and failure. Older Hillside homes may have suboptimal installations that have never been updated, increasing leak risk.
Warning Signs of a Failing Water Heater
- Rust-Colored or Cloudy Hot Water: If your hot water appears rusty, discolored, or cloudy, the tank's interior is beginning to corrode. This is an early warning that the tank structure is degrading and a leak could develop soon.
- Loud Rumbling or Popping Sounds: Sediment at the bottom of the tank creates popping or rumbling noises as the heater cycles. These sounds indicate heavy sediment buildup and are a sign that failure is likely within months if the tank is not flushed or replaced.
- Warm Spots on the Tank or Pipe Connections: If you notice the tank itself or the pipes connected to it are unusually warm to the touch, or if you feel heat radiating from the foundation below the tank, this signals a leak or structural failure in progress.
- Visible Water Pooling or Dampness Around the Tank: Any visible water, dampness, or staining on the floor around the water heater is a clear sign of a leak. Even a small weep that leaves only a damp ring requires immediate attention.
- Reduced Hot Water Supply or Temperature Fluctuations: If the tank suddenly delivers less hot water than usual, or if hot water temperature is inconsistent, the tank may be corroding internally or the heating element may be failing due to sediment interference.
- Age Beyond 10–15 Years: If your water heater is approaching or past 10–15 years old and has not been recently flushed or serviced, it is approaching high-risk age and should be inspected by a professional to assess remaining lifespan.

What causes water heater leaks in Hillside homes?
Water heater leaks in Hillside are primarily caused by sediment buildup from hard water, corrosion of tank walls over time, and age-related wear. The Chicago area's hard water deposits calcium and magnesium inside tanks, increasing internal pressure and accelerating corrosion. As tanks age beyond 10–15 years, the combination of corrosion and pressure makes leaks increasingly likely. Improper maintenance, such as skipping annual flushing, also accelerates this process. Older Hillside homes may have original or outdated water heater installations that lack proper support or protection from environmental factors, further increasing leak risk.
How quickly can a water heater leak cause damage?
Damage speed depends on the leak's size and location. A small weep may go unnoticed for days or weeks, silently pooling water in the basement and creating conditions for mold growth. A significant leak can saturate a basement in hours, damaging flooring, drywall, personal belongings, and electrical systems. The worst-case scenario—a full tank rupture—can release hundreds of gallons in minutes. Even slow leaks pose serious risks: standing water promotes mold, which becomes a health hazard and is costly to remediate. Early detection is critical to limiting damage and avoiding emergency restoration.
Should I replace or repair a leaking water heater?
Most water heater leaks cannot be repaired—once the tank itself leaks, replacement is necessary because the structural integrity is compromised and further failure is imminent. Repairs may be possible for minor issues like a faulty TPR valve or loose connection, but these are quick diagnostics a plumber can make. If the tank is leaking, replacement is the only safe option. For tanks beyond 8 years old, replacement is often more economical than repair, since an older tank is likely to fail again soon. A professional inspection can determine the best course of action.
How can I prevent water heater leaks?
Annual or biennial flushing removes sediment and slows corrosion significantly, especially in hard-water areas like Hillside. Flushing is a low-cost maintenance step that can extend your water heater's life by several years. Inspecting the tank and connections quarterly for signs of rust, dampness, or discoloration helps catch early problems. If your water heater is beyond 10 years old, have a professional inspect the anode rod and TPR valve to assess remaining life. Installing the water heater in a well-draining location, with proper support and ventilation, also reduces risk. Regular maintenance is far cheaper than emergency replacement and restoration.
What should I do immediately if my water heater is leaking?
First, shut off the water supply to the water heater—the shutoff valve is typically located at the cold-water inlet at the top of the tank. Next, turn off power to the heater (for electric heaters, flip the circuit breaker; for gas heaters, turn the knob to "pilot" or "off"). Open a hot-water faucet in the house to relieve pressure and allow remaining water to drain from the tank and pipes. Move valuable items away from the affected area to prevent water damage. Call a licensed plumber immediately to assess and replace the tank. In the meantime, mop up standing water to prevent mold growth.
Is a leaking water heater a health hazard?
A leaking water heater is primarily a property-damage hazard, but it can create secondary health risks. Standing water in a basement provides the ideal environment for mold growth, which can cause respiratory issues and allergic reactions, especially in children and people with asthma. Mold can spread throughout a home if water damage is not promptly addressed and the area thoroughly dried. Electrical hazards may also arise if water contacts electrical wiring, outlets, or the heater's electrical components. The longer water stands, the greater the mold risk. Prompt water extraction and thorough drying, followed by mold inspection if needed, protect both your property and your family's health.
